Indians outfielder Yasiel Puig has dropped his appeal for his three-game suspension for his part in the brawl against Pittsburgh July 30, according to Fox Sports.  Puig was playing for the Cincinnati Reds when he was involved in benches-clearing brawl against the Pirates.  He will serve the suspension immediately and he will miss the Tribe’s three-game series against the Red Sox.

Puig is batting .357 with one HR and six RBIs in 11 games with Cleveland.
